What Does a Garage Conversion Engineer Do?

**Direct Answer:** A garage conversion engineer evaluates existing garage structures, designs modifications to meet residential building codes, creates structural plans for new floor systems, wall modifications, and foundation upgrades, and provides PE-stamped drawings for permit approval. In California, engineers ensure garage conversions comply with California Building Code requirements for habitable spaces, including load-bearing capacity, lateral resistance, ceiling heights, and egress requirements.

Key Engineering Tasks:

**Structural Assessment**

  • Evaluate existing garage structure
  • Check foundation adequacy
  • Assess wall and roof capacity
  • Identify required modifications

**Floor System Design**

  • Raise floor level if needed (garage floors typically slope)
  • Design subfloor framing over existing slab
  • Insulation and moisture barrier requirements
  • Floor load capacity for residential use

**Wall Modifications**

  • New window and door openings
  • Removal of garage door structure
  • Infill wall construction
  • Lateral bracing requirements

**Foundation Evaluation**

  • Existing footing adequacy
  • Potential thickening or underpinning
  • Connection to new walls

Why Do Coronado Garage Conversions Need Engineering?

**Direct Answer:** Coronado garage conversions need engineering because garages weren't designed as habitable space—they have lower ceiling heights, sloped floors, inadequate insulation, and different structural requirements than living areas. California Building Code requires habitable spaces to meet specific standards for floor loads (40 psf minimum), ceiling height (7' minimum), egress windows, and lateral resistance. A licensed engineer ensures conversions meet these requirements safely.

Code Differences Between Garages and Living Space:

**Floor Requirements**

  • Garage: 4" slab, often sloped, designed for vehicle loads (point loads)
  • Living: Level floor, 40 psf uniform live load, insulated

**Ceiling Height**

  • Garage: No minimum (often 8-9')
  • Living: 7' minimum habitable rooms
  • Need to verify adequate height after raised floor

**Wall Construction**

  • Garage: May have fire-rated assembly to house
  • Living: Requires insulation, electrical, proper framing

**Egress Requirements**

  • Garage: No egress windows required
  • Living: Egress windows required in bedrooms

**Seismic/Lateral Systems**

  • Garage: Relies on garage door opening (weak point)
  • Living: Must provide adequate bracing

What Is the Garage Conversion Process in Coronado?

**Direct Answer:** The garage conversion process in Coronado typically involves initial consultation with an engineer, site evaluation, structural design, plan preparation, permit application to Coronado Building Department, construction, and final inspection. Timeline is typically 2-4 weeks for engineering, 2-4 weeks for permits, and 4-8 weeks for construction. Total project duration is 3-5 months from start to occupancy.

Phase 1: Engineering (2-4 weeks)

**Initial Consultation**

  • Site visit to evaluate garage
  • Discuss conversion goals
  • Identify structural requirements
  • Provide fee estimate

**Design Development**

  • Structural calculations
  • Floor framing design
  • Wall modification details
  • Foundation assessment

**Plan Preparation**

  • Architectural floor plan
  • Structural plans
  • Construction details
  • PE stamp and signature

Phase 2: Permitting (2-4 weeks)

**City of Coronado Submission**

  • Permit application
  • Plan sets
  • Plan check fees
  • Review and corrections

Phase 3: Construction (4-8 weeks)

**Typical Construction Sequence:**

  • Garage door removal and infill
  • Electrical and plumbing rough-in
  • Floor system installation
  • Insulation and drywall
  • Finishes
  • Final inspections

How Much Does Garage Conversion Engineering Cost in Coronado?

**Direct Answer (2025 Pricing):** Garage conversion engineering in Coronado typically costs $2,500-$5,000 for standard single or two-car garage conversions. Complex conversions with significant structural modifications run $4,000-$7,000. This represents 3-5% of typical total conversion costs of $50,000-$150,000. Engineering fees include site evaluation, structural design, and PE-stamped plans for permit application.

Engineering Costs:

**Standard Conversions (Coronado)**

  • Single-car garage: $2,500-$3,500
  • Two-car garage: $3,000-$4,500
  • With bathroom addition: $3,500-$5,500

**Complex Conversions:**

  • Major structural changes: $4,000-$6,000
  • Second-story above: $5,000-$8,000
  • ADU with separate entry: $4,000-$6,500

**Total Conversion Cost Context:**

  • Basic conversion: $40,000-$60,000
  • Standard with bath: $60,000-$100,000
  • Full ADU: $100,000-$175,000
  • Engineering: 3-5% of total

What Are Common Garage Conversion Challenges in Coronado?

**Direct Answer:** Common garage conversion challenges in Coronado include low ceiling heights requiring careful floor system design, sloped garage floors needing level floor solutions, inadequate foundations requiring reinforcement, parking replacement requirements, and historic district considerations. Solutions include engineered sleeper floor systems, foundation thickening, tandem parking configurations, and designs respecting neighborhood character.

Challenge 1: Ceiling Height

**Problem:** After adding raised floor, ceiling may be below 7' minimum.

**Solution:**

  • Low-profile floor systems
  • Recessing into existing slab
  • Exposed ceiling (removing drywall)
  • May eliminate some garages as candidates

Challenge 2: Sloped Floors

**Problem:** Garage floors slope 1/8" to 1/4" per foot for drainage.

**Solution:**

  • Tapered sleepers
  • Self-leveling systems
  • Raised floor framing
  • Engineering for drainage underneath

Challenge 3: Foundation Adequacy

**Problem:** Garage foundations may not meet living space requirements.

**Coronado Example:** A 1940s garage had 8" stem walls inadequate for new exterior door opening.

**Solution:**

  • Foundation assessment
  • Thickening if needed
  • New footings for modifications
  • Connection to existing structure

Frequently Asked Questions About Garage Conversions in Coronado

**Can I convert my garage without engineering?** Simple cosmetic changes may not require engineering, but any structural modifications, load-bearing changes, or permit requirements in Coronado typically require PE-stamped plans. The Building Department determines specific requirements.

**Do I need to replace parking when converting my garage?** Coronado's parking requirements have been relaxed under California ADU laws. Many conversions don't require parking replacement if within 1/2 mile of transit or meeting other exemptions. Verify current requirements with the city.

**How long is a garage conversion permit valid?** Coronado building permits are typically valid for 6 months to 1 year, with extensions available. Construction should begin promptly after permit issuance.
